I was wondering where we’d go after having two weeks to ponder our last new episode where Reese and Finch finally meet up with the criminal Elias. Surely, it would be too soon to bring Elias back. So would we end up with just a cookie-cutter episode?

Not at all. The Elias saga gets put on the back burner as Alan Dale, who has more recurring TV characters than Elias has victims (think 24, Lost, The OC…and many more), steps in as Ulrich Kohl, a former member of the Stasi, East Germany’s secret police force, during the 1980’s. So what we have this week are two professional killers – Reese and Kohl – going head to head. The results are satisfying on a number of levels.

CBS Announces Plans For More Survivor…This Year and Next Year

survivor

CBS announced today the next Survivor edition will premiere Wednesday, Feb. 15 (8:00 PM, ET/PT) and also ordered two more editions of the series for broadcast during the 2012-2013 season. The broadcasts next season will mark the 25th and 26th editions of television’s longest-running hit reality competition series.

Emmy Award winner Jeff Probst will return as host and executive producer for all three upcoming cycles. Probst has hosted SURVIVOR since its inception in May 2000.

Ricky Gervais Returns at Golden Globes Host

gervais

Multi-talented Golden Globe and Emmy Award winner Ricky Gervais (“The Office,” “The Ricky Gervais Show”) has signed for the third time to return as host of NBC’s “The 69th Annual Golden Globe Awards” on Sunday, January 15, 2012. This year’s show will again be broadcast live coast-to-coast from 5-8 p.m. (PT) and 8-11 p.m. (ET) from the Beverly Hilton Hotel in Beverly Hills.

The announcement was made today by the Hollywood Foreign Press Association President Dr. Aida Takla O’Reilly, dick clark productions and NBC.
